Subject: Seed samples heading out Thursday

Hi dispatch,

Quick one — the Brindlewood trial-plot seed samples are boxed and waiting at the Marrow Lane depot. They're moisture-sensitive, so keep them off the loading dock and in the van last-minute. Have whoever's driving check the batch tags against the manifest. One more thing for the hand-over, and it stays between us.

handover note for yagef-bagep: the drudor pelius courier leaves the kasdor zorvan norir ledger at gate 8016 under passcode 755406

ALERT: Greenhouse controller sensor drift (Verdanhall Bay 3). This fires when the humidity probes diverge from the reference sensor by more than 4% over a rolling six-hour window. Past incidents trace to condensation on the probe housing or calibration decay after roughly ninety days in service. Do not simply re-zero the sensor; confirm against the handheld meter first, then log the calibration event. Full drift-handling procedure is on the internal page below.

wiki page, tahaf-tajog: https://jira.ordindyn.corp/pipeline

Subject: Quickstore 4.2 — bloom filter now fronts the KV layer

Plugin authors: starting with this release, Quickstore places a bloom filter ahead of the key-value store. Negative lookups return faster; false positives fall through safely. No API changes are required on your side. Verify your plugin against the staging build referenced below.

session token of fahif-tadup = htk3_9c7

**Item 14 — Cold storage bucket archiving.** Verify that all Lanthorn buckets older than 180 days were moved to the archive tier, that lifecycle rules are enforced automatically rather than by manual script, and that access logs for archived buckets are retained for one year. Confirm checksums were validated post-transfer. Any exceptions must be documented and countersigned by the accountable owner named below.

named custodian: Brivan Eliath Quenox Frador